Many research projects at Northwestern University are coming to a stop. The Trump administration is cutting $790 million dollars in federal funding for the university. That money would go towards a variety of research projects from developing new technologies to disease research. On top of those cuts, the U.S. Department of Defense sent more than 100 stop-work orders to university research staff. To learn more, we spoke to a Northwestern researcher being affected by cuts and work stoppages.

In the Chicago area and beyond, international students are having their J-1 and F-1 visas revoked. Their universities and the federal government have provided little-to-no information regarding why their status was changed. Some students had participated in protests. Others have minor misdemeanors on their records. Reset explores what’s happening and what it says about the current state of free speech on college campuses.
